The wave parameters such as wave height and period are analyzed and the potential wave power density values … WebNorth Carolina experienced temperatures over 100 °F (37.8 °C). In Charlotte, a record high of "104 °F (40.0 °C) degrees [was] set on 10 August 2007," that lasted until August 2012. Ten years later, the National Weather Service labeled the August 2007 heat wave one of the "Historic Heat Waves in the Carolinas."
